tarbimiskrediit
Tarbimiskrediit, also known as consumer credit, refers to a loan extended to an individual to finance the purchase of goods or services that are not immediately affordable. These loans are typically used for personal consumption rather than business investment. Common examples of items purchased with consumer credit include vehicles, appliances, furniture, and electronics. The credit can be provided by various financial institutions such as banks, credit unions, and specialized lending companies.
The terms of a tarbimiskrediit agreement include an interest rate, repayment period, and any associated fees.
